This was created as a wedding gift for two great friends of ours who were married this past weekend on 4/6/2013.

I like to take pieces that the couple includes on their invitation or announcement and create a gift from them. This happened to be on their wedding invitation - they used actual Scrabble tiles and her engagement ring to spell the work "Love" and I took one look at it and knew it would make a great wall hanging.

Each tile in the hanging measures 4×4.125 (a tad taller than wider) and is solid cherry. I used my CNC Router to do the lettering on them. The ring was cut out with my scrollsaw. Overall dimensions, of course, are around 8 inches square.

Finish was a coat of Danish Oil and then a few coats of spray lacquer.
